AN ACT TO PROVIDE THAT THE PRECINCT LINES IN SPARTANBURG COUNTY SHALL BE DEFINED AS SHOWN ON MAPS FILED WITH THE CLERK OF COURT OF THE COUNTY AND ON FILE WITH THE STATE ELECTION COMMISSION AND THE DIVISION OF RESEARCH AND STATISTICAL SERVICES OF THE STATE BUDGET AND CONTROL BOARD.
Be it enacted by the General Assembly of the State of South Carolina:
Precinct lines defined as shown on maps
Section 1. Notwithstanding any other provision of law, on the effective date of this act, the precinct lines defining the precincts in Spartanburg County are as shown on maps filed with the clerk of court of the county and on file with the State Election Commission and the Division of Research and Statistical Services of the State Budget and Control Board.
Time effective
Section 2. This act shall take effect upon the approval by the Governor.
